Ingredients You’ll Need
Here’s what you’ll need to craft your own Mint Sauvignon Blanc Smash. All measurements are for one serving unless otherwise noted.
For One Serving:
- 4 oz (½ cup) chilled Sauvignon Blanc white wine
- ½ oz (1 tablespoon) fresh lime juice (about ½ lime)
- ½ oz (1 tablespoon) simple syrup (or agave nectar for vegan option)
- 6–8 fresh mint leaves
- Lime wheel or extra mint sprig for garnish

Step-by-Step Instructions
Follow these steps to create the perfect Mint Sauvignon Blanc Smash:
- Muddle the mint: Place mint leaves in your glass and gently press down with a muddler or spoon. Don’t overdo it—you want to release oils, not crush the leaves into mush.
- Add lime juice and syrup: Squeeze in fresh lime juice and add simple syrup. Stir gently to combine.
- Pour the wine: Slowly pour chilled Sauvignon Blanc over ice. Avoid pouring too fast to prevent splashing.
- Top with club soda (optional): If desired, add a splash of club soda for extra fizz.
- Garnish and serve immediately: Finish with a lime wheel or mint sprig. Grab a straw and enjoy!

Pro Tips for the Perfect Smash
- Chill everything: Serve over plenty of ice. Warm ingredients dilute the drink quickly and dull the flavors.
- Use quality wine: Mid-range Sauvignon Blancs from New Zealand or California work great—no need for expensive bottles.
- Adjust sweetness: Taste before adding more syrup. Some limes are juicier than others.
- Don’t skip muddling: Even light pressing releases essential oils—this is key to authentic flavor.
- Make it ahead? Not recommended—the mint loses potency within 30 minutes.
